英文摘要
In Canada, the deficit to fix existing infrastructure is increasing at an alarming rate. Some estimates put thedeficit to fix bridges alone at $8 billion. This project will aim at developing an innovative Non-destructivetechniques for condition assessment of deteriorating structures such as parking garages and bridge decks and todetermine the delamination growth rate when repaired using a repair material. Further, this project aims atevaluating the bond strength of the repaired material, develop an autonomous, in-situ, and non-contactmultipurpose rig that will consist of different types of NDT equipment. The rig will gather real-time data andsimultaneously marks (using different colors) on the structure, being examined, which are outside thepredetermined limit. It is strongly believed that the findings of this project will help RJC on various futureprojects. Specifically, this project will help quantify the remaining service life of structures and assist owners indetermining the intervention time for repair or structural retrofit. Thus, resulting in huge tax dollar savings andinfrastructure safety improvement. Also, lead to the development of both a greater understanding of the spreadof corrosion, as well as the refinement of rapid assessment techniques, which is essential for not only publicsafety but also public spending. With the ability to conservatively predict the spread of corrosion anddelamination, timelines can be determined when assessing the risk and costs associated with delaying repair.Rapid assessment will also lower the costs to perform the assessments, allowing for existing budgets toaccommodate more testing.
